MES Students Treated To TinCaps Game
On Wednesday May 8, the Meadowview Elementary Title 1 students,
who completed all of the assigned
skills, spent the day watching the Fort
Wayne TinCaps play the Great Lakes
Loons. Students were treated to the
baseball game and a free lunch courtesy of the Fort Wayne TinCaps. Meadowview Elementary was 1 of over 280
schools participating in the program
this school year.
